Templated‐Construction of Hollow MoS(2) Architectures with Improved Photoresponses

Despite the outstanding optoelectronic properties of MoS(2) and its analogues, synthesis of such materials with desired features including fewer layers, arbitrary hollow structures, and particularly specifically customized morphologies, via inorganic reactions has always been challenging.
